Four hours is enough to hit the landmarks that define Medellín without rushing. Your guide picks you up from your hotel in a private vehicle and takes you first to Botero Plaza, where 23 sculptures by Fernando Botero sit in the open air—the artist donated them to the city, and they anchor the tour. From there, you board the Metrocable, the cable car that climbs the hillside. The ride itself is the point: you see how the neighborhoods perched above the city have the best views, and the guide explains what you're looking at as you ascend. The cable car is how locals move around, so you're traveling the way the city does.
The tour ends at one of the largest street art zones in the Americas. By that point you've moved through three different Medellíns—the formal plaza, the hillside communities, the painted walls—without the logistics of figuring out how to get between them. What are the 23 statues at Botero Plaza?
Fernando Botero, Colombia's most famous sculptor, donated 23 of his works to Medellín, and they're displayed permanently in Botero Plaza in the city center. The sculptures are large, abstract figures in Botero's distinctive style—you walk among them in the open plaza.
What does the Metrocable cable car show you?
The Metrocable climbs the hillside to the neighborhoods above the city, and the ride gives you a view of how those communities sit above Medellín. The guide explains the city layout and the communities as you ascend, and you see the contrast between the formal downtown and the hillside residential areas.
